| hello everybody, i just wanted to know the appropriate word or sentence that i can use at death situation...and can i use " GOD BLess Your Soul" ? thanx |
|
#2
| ||||
| ||||
| Yes, you can say that. Think of death as you would in your own language and say waht you feel. t will be ok |
|
#3
| ||||
| ||||
| You could console the relatives of the deceased by saying:" Please accept my deepest condolences". Last edited by summer rain; 10-Apr-2008 at 19:29. |
